II Chronicles 7:14 (NIV)

14 If my people, who are called by my name, will humble themselves and pray and seek my face and turn from their wicked ways, then will I hear from heaven and will forgive their sin and will heal their land.


It says if we do these 4 things:
1. Humble ourselves
2. Pray
3. Seek God's face
4. Turn from our wicked ways (genuinely repent)

Then God will do the following 3 things:
1. Hear us from heaven
2. Forgive our sin
3. Heal our lands

I interpret the promise to heal our lands as a healing of our lives and the things that surround us, in the case of individuals. This may be an incorrect interpretation, but it seems consistent with what I know of God.
